The Compliance Framework: Step-by-Step

Execute a defensible performance process in 4 phases

Phase 1

Set Up Defensible Processes

1A

Write clear job descriptions and performance expectations

1B

Create calibration meeting framework (consistency + documentation)

1C

Build manager documentation templates (coaching, feedback, goals)

1D

Define promotion and termination decision criteria

Phase 2

Execute with Compliance

2A

Document all coaching conversations (real-time, not retroactive)

2B

Run calibration meetings (documented, consistent standards)

2C

Create performance ratings with evidence (not subjective)

2D

Tie compensation decisions to documented ratings

Phase 3

Make Defensible Decisions

3A

Document promotion decisions (criteria, evaluation, reasoning)

3B

Document pay decisions (market analysis, performance tied to pay)

3C

Create performance improvement plans (clear, specific, fair)

3D

Termination (progressive discipline trail, clear business reason)

Phase 4

Prepare for Audits & Challenges

4A

Audit your data for demographic patterns (proactive)

4B

Document your analysis and remediation plans

4C

Prepare for regulatory audit (EEOC, state labor board)

4D

Maintain records retention per legal requirements
